About the course

Join us for this Risk Live Australia in-person workshop to enhance your knowledge about liquidity risk management and gain valuable insights into the best practices for liquidity stress-testing.

Learn about the liquidity risk management strategies being implemented in the financial industry, and study fundamental principles such as liquidity coverage ratio, NSFR and high-quality liquid assets. Key sessions will address topics related to funding and how to prepare for future events.

Participants will engage in interactive discussions and case studies alongside peers and the expert tutor, while equipping themselves with the tools to successfully monitor and manage liquidity risks.

Learning objectives

  • Identify stress event triggers and appropriate responses
  • Navigate the drivers of liquidity risk and implications of liquidity strains
  • Implement liquidity metrics and monitoring tools
  • Manage the data requirements for liquidity stress-testing
  • Assess liquidity transfer pricing and indirect liquidity cost
  • Develop a robust framework to manage liquidity risk
